Home
last modified time | relevance | path

Searched refs:FRV_CACHE (Results 1 – 13 of 13) sorted by relevance

/netbsd/src/external/gpl3/gdb/dist/sim/frv/
Dcache.h179 } FRV_CACHE; typedef
219 frv_cache_init (SIM_CPU *, FRV_CACHE *);
221 frv_cache_term (FRV_CACHE *);
223 frv_cache_reconfigure (SIM_CPU *, FRV_CACHE *);
225 frv_cache_enabled (FRV_CACHE *);
231 frv_cache_read (FRV_CACHE *, int, SI);
233 frv_cache_write (FRV_CACHE *, SI, char *, unsigned);
235 frv_cache_preload (FRV_CACHE *, SI, USI, int);
237 frv_cache_unlock (FRV_CACHE *, SI);
239 frv_cache_invalidate (FRV_CACHE *, SI, int);
[all …]
Dcache.c33 frv_cache_init (SIM_CPU *cpu, FRV_CACHE *cache) in frv_cache_init()
105 frv_cache_term (FRV_CACHE *cache) in frv_cache_term()
116 frv_cache_reconfigure (SIM_CPU *current_cpu, FRV_CACHE *cache) in frv_cache_reconfigure()
150 frv_cache_enabled (FRV_CACHE *cache) in frv_cache_enabled()
164 ram_access (FRV_CACHE *cache, USI address) in ram_access()
202 non_cache_access (FRV_CACHE *cache, USI address) in non_cache_access()
257 get_tag (FRV_CACHE *cache, SI address, FRV_CACHE_TAG **return_tag) in get_tag()
302 write_data_to_memory (FRV_CACHE *cache, SI address, char *data, int length) in write_data_to_memory()
335 write_line_to_memory (FRV_CACHE *cache, FRV_CACHE_TAG *tag) in write_line_to_memory()
363 fill_line_from_memory (FRV_CACHE *cache, FRV_CACHE_TAG *tag, SI address) in fill_line_from_memory()
[all …]
Dmemory.c274 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_read_mem_QI()
306 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_read_mem_UQI()
348 FRV_CACHE *cache; in frvbf_read_mem_HI()
389 FRV_CACHE *cache; in frvbf_read_mem_UHI()
430 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in read_mem_unaligned_SI()
467 FRV_CACHE *cache; in frvbf_read_mem_SI()
514 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in read_mem_unaligned_DI()
587 FRV_CACHE *cache; in frvbf_read_mem_DI()
627 FRV_CACHE *cache; in frvbf_read_mem_DF()
672 FRV_CACHE *cache; in frvbf_read_imem_USI()
[all …]
Dprofile.h167 void request_cache_flush (SIM_CPU *, FRV_CACHE *, int);
168 void request_cache_invalidate (SIM_CPU *, FRV_CACHE *, int);
169 void request_cache_preload (SIM_CPU *, FRV_CACHE *, int);
170 void request_cache_unlock (SIM_CPU *, FRV_CACHE *, int);
Doptions.c118 FRV_CACHE *cache = is_data_cache ? CPU_DATA_CACHE (current_cpu) in parse_cache_option()
216 FRV_CACHE *insn_cache = CPU_INSN_CACHE (cpu); in frv_option_handler()
217 FRV_CACHE *data_cache = CPU_DATA_CACHE (cpu); in frv_option_handler()
Dsim-main.h71 FRV_CACHE insn_cache;
74 FRV_CACHE data_cache;
Dreset.c36 FRV_CACHE *insn_cache = CPU_INSN_CACHE (current_cpu); in frv_initialize()
37 FRV_CACHE *data_cache = CPU_DATA_CACHE (current_cpu); in frv_initialize()
Dprofile.c136 FRV_CACHE *cache;
202 request_cache_flush (SIM_CPU *cpu, FRV_CACHE *cache, int cycles) in request_cache_flush()
231 request_cache_invalidate (SIM_CPU *cpu, FRV_CACHE *cache, int cycles) in request_cache_invalidate()
260 request_cache_preload (SIM_CPU *cpu, FRV_CACHE *cache, int cycles) in request_cache_preload()
292 request_cache_unlock (SIM_CPU *cpu, FRV_CACHE *cache, int cycles) in request_cache_unlock()
458 copy_load_data (SIM_CPU *current_cpu, FRV_CACHE *cache, int slot, in copy_load_data()
563 FRV_CACHE* cache; in request_complete()
605 FRV_CACHE* data_cache = CPU_DATA_CACHE (cpu); in run_caches()
606 FRV_CACHE* insn_cache = CPU_INSN_CACHE (cpu); in run_caches()
1952 print_cache (SIM_CPU *cpu, FRV_CACHE *cache, const char *cache_name) in print_cache()
Dfrv.c1442 FRV_CACHE *cache = CPU_INSN_CACHE (current_cpu); in frvbf_insn_cache_preload()
1465 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_data_cache_preload()
1484 FRV_CACHE *cache = CPU_INSN_CACHE (current_cpu); in frvbf_insn_cache_unlock()
1503 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_data_cache_unlock()
1532 FRV_CACHE *cache = CPU_INSN_CACHE (current_cpu); in frvbf_insn_cache_invalidate()
1563 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_data_cache_invalidate()
1594 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_data_cache_flush()
Dmloop.in229 FRV_CACHE *cache;
293 FRV_CACHE *cache;
Dtraps.c679 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in frvbf_check_recovering_store()
Dinterrupts.c534 FRV_CACHE *cache = CPU_DATA_CACHE (current_cpu); in check_reset()
DChangeLog-20211636 (FRV_CACHE): Add pipeline, statistics, BARS and NARS.
2126 * cache.h (FRV_CACHE): Add memory_latency field.
2253 * cache.h (FRV_CACHE): Add last_was_hit field.